> > These should also set GPn_FN - to zero for GPIO output, 3 for GPIO
> > input.  Otherwise changing between input and output mode at runtime
> > won't do the right thing.  As a side effect of that you probably
> > wouldn't need to specify the GPIO configuration in platform data.

> Ooops. I didn't notice that. How does this interact with bit 7; GPn_DIR? I
> assume both need to be set appropriately since they're both defined bits.

Yes, one controls the function and the other controls the pad mode.
